8 Detailed Description
8.1 Overview
These octal bus transceivers are designed for asynchronous two-way communication between data buses. The
control-function implementation minimizes external timing requirements. The SNx4HC245 devices allow data
transmission from the A bus to the B bus or from the B bus to the A bus, depending on the logic level at the
direction-control (DIR) input. The output-enable (OE) input can be used to disable the device so that the buses
are effectively isolated. To ensure the high-impedance state during power up or power down, OE should be tied
to VCC through a pullup resistor; the minimum value of the resistor is determined by the current-sinking
capability of the driver.

9 Application and Implementation
NOTE
Information in the following applications sections is not part of the TI component
specification, and TI does not warrant its accuracy or completeness. TI’s customers are
responsible for determining suitability of components for their purposes. Customers should
validate and test their design implementation to confirm system functionality.
9.1 Application Information
The SNx4HC245 is a low-drive CMOS device that can be used for a multitude of bus interface type applications
where output ringing is a concern. The low drive and slow edge rates will minimize overshoot and undershoot on
the outputs.

9.2.1 Design Requirements
This device uses CMOS technology and has balanced output drive. Care should be taken to avoid bus
contention because it can drive currents that would exceed maximum limits. Outputs can be combined to
produce higher drive but the high drive will also create faster edges into light loads, so routing and load
conditions should be considered to prevent ringing.
9.2.2 Detailed Design Procedure
1. Recommended Input Conditions
– Rise time and fall time specs: See (Δt/ΔV) in the Recommended Operating Conditions.
– Specified high and low levels: See (VIH and VIL) in the Recommended Operating Conditions.
2. Recommend Output Conditions
– Load currents should not exceed 25 mA per output and 75 mA total for the part.
– Outputs should not be pulled above VCC.

10 Power Supply Recommendations
The power supply can be any voltage between the MIN and MAX supply voltage rating located in the
Recommended Operating Conditions.
Each VCC pin should have a good bypass capacitor to prevent power disturbance. For devices with a single
supply, 0.1 μF is recommended; if there are multiple VCC pins, then 0.01 μF or 0.022 μF is recommended for
each power pin. It is acceptable to parallel multiple bypass caps to reject different frequencies of noise. A 0.1 μF
and a 1 μF are commonly used in parallel. The bypass capacitor should be installed as close to the power pin as
possible for best results.
11 Layout
11.1 Layout Guidelines
When using multiple-bit logic devices, inputs should never float.
In many cases, functions or parts of functions of digital logic devices are unused, for example, when only two
inputs of a triple-input AND gate are used or only 3 of the 4 buffer gates are used. Such input pins should not be
left unconnected because the undefined voltages at the outside connections result in undefined operational
states. Figure 6 specifies the rules that must be observed under all circumstances. All unused inputs of digital
logic devices must be connected to a high or low bias to prevent them from floating. The logic level that should
be applied to any particular unused input depends on the function of the device. Generally they will be tied to
GND or VCC, whichever makes more sense or is more convenient. It is generally acceptable to float outputs,
unless the part is a transceiver. If the transceiver has an output enable pin, it will disable the output section of the
part when asserted. This will not disable the input section of the IOs, so they cannot float when disabled.

12.4 Electrostatic Discharge Caution
These devices have limited built-in ESD protection. The leads should be shorted together or the device placed in conductive foam
during storage or handling to prevent electrostatic damage to the MOS gates.

The marketing status values are defined as follows:
ACTIVE: Product device recommended for new designs.
LIFEBUY: TI has announced that the device will be discontinued, and a lifetime-buy period is in effect.
NRND: Not recommended for new designs. Device is in production to support existing customers, but TI does not recommend using this part in a new design.
PREVIEW: Device has been announced but is not in production. Samples may or may not be available.
OBSOLETE: TI has discontinued the production of the device.
(2)
Eco Plan - The planned eco-friendly classification: Pb-Free (RoHS), Pb-Free (RoHS Exempt), or Green (RoHS & no Sb/Br) - please check http://www.ti.com/productcontent for the latest availability
information and additional product content details.
TBD: The Pb-Free/Green conversion plan has not been defined.
Pb-Free (RoHS): TI's terms "Lead-Free" or "Pb-Free" mean semiconductor products that are compatible with the current RoHS requirements for all 6 substances, including the requirement that
lead not exceed 0.1% by weight in homogeneous materials. Where designed to be soldered at high temperatures, TI Pb-Free products are suitable for use in specified lead-free processes.
Pb-Free (RoHS Exempt): This component has a RoHS exemption for either 1) lead-based flip-chip solder bumps used between the die and package, or 2) lead-based die adhesive used between
the die and leadframe. The component is otherwise considered Pb-Free (RoHS compatible) as defined above.
Green (RoHS & no Sb/Br): TI defines "Green" to mean Pb-Free (RoHS compatible), and free of Bromine (Br) and Antimony (Sb) based flame retardants (Br or Sb do not exceed 0.1% by weight
in homogeneous material)
